Drainage and Grading Solutions

Improper drainage leads to soggy lawns, eroded soil, and foundation damage—common issues in the rainy PNW climate. A qualified site planner designs effective water redirection methods like rain gardens. Combined with proper earth shaping, these systems protect your property and create a healthier yard.

Lacking proper planning, even the most beautiful landscapes can fail. But with smart engineering, your yard becomes both dry and visually appealing.

Project Cost and Timeline

Average Design Fee Range

Estimating the expense of working with a design expert in Bellevue WA depends on yard size. Most property beautification projects start between $2,500 and $7,500 for conceptual plans, with larger estates or retail outdoor spaces ranging higher. These fees typically cover planting layouts tailored to the local environmental standards.

Design and Build Timelines

Most outdoor design projects in Bellevue WA span anywhere from 6 to 16 weeks from client meeting to final installation. The planning stage usually lasts 3–6 weeks, allowing time for hardscaping layouts. Once approved, the build phase can vary between 4 to 12 weeks, depending on material availability. Seasonal challenges like PNW rain or permit reviews may impact the delivery window.

Sustainable Design Practices

Natural Drainage Systems

Rain gardens are a eco-friendly solution for managing runoff in the King County. Designed by a outdoor planner, these systems use native plants to detain stormwater before it enters local waterways. They’re especially useful in areas with poor yard grading, and often align with stormwater codes.

Eco-Friendly Hardscaping

Impervious concrete and asphalt increase runoff and flooding—especially in urban Eastside neighborhoods. Porous concrete offer a sustainable alternative that allows water to percolate into the ground. These paving options are ideal for walkways, and when combined with proper site planning, they help meet King County standards.
